Case report: Onychopapilloma in a patient with BAP1 tumor predisposition syndrome-a useful clinical marker?

The BAP1 gene encodes a tumor suppressor protein implicated in BAP1 tumor predisposition syndrome (BAP1-TPDS), a hereditary condition associated with an increased risk of uveal and skin melanoma, mesothelioma, and renal cancer. In this case report, we describe a male patient diagnosed with mesothelioma carrying a germline BAP1 variant. The patient exhibited severe nail abnormalities affecting all ten fingernails...
